Limited budgets, small teams, and competing priorities require pragmatic, high-value solutions
High visibility, ministerial involvement, and cross-party considerations shape every decision
Informal networks, cross-departmental working, and personal relationships matter
Different rules, smaller markets, and limited supplier competition create unique challenges
Jurisdictional data requirements and cloud adoption constraints require careful navigation
Small talent pools and external opportunity pull make capability building critical
